#cace2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cace2e is composed of 79.2% red, 80.8%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.7%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 61.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 49.4%. #cace2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#959d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#cace2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cace2e has RGB values of R:202, G:206,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13291054.

Shades and Tints of #cace2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0e03 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#cace2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80807c is the less saturated color, while #eff507 is the most saturated one.
